摘要:
In the title three-dimensional tetra-zolate-based coordination polymer, poly[bis-(μ3-cyanido-κ3 N:C:C)[μ5- 5-(pyridin-4-yl)tetrazolato-κ5 N:N':N″:N‴: N′‴]tricopper(I)], [Cu3(C6H4N 5)(CN)2]n, there are two types of coordinated CuI atoms. One type exhibits a tetra-hedral environment and the other, residing on a twofold axis, adopts a trigonal coordination environment.
